Emergency Medicine Specialist Dr. Zübeyde Albayrak said that the increasing heat in the city causes premature aging and skin cancer. Stating that extreme temperatures bring health problems, Dr. Albayrak noted that when the increasing ambient temperature exceeds the body temperature, the body absorbs the heat in the environment and the body temperature starts to increase. Stating that in this newly developing situation, metabolism activates some mechanisms to adapt to this situation, Dr. Albayrak said, “Sweating is one of these mechanisms. However, sweating alone is not always a sufficient mechanism to lower body temperature. With increasing temperature, the metabolic rate increases and the amount of oxygen consumed increases. Accordingly, respiratory rate increases and heart rate increases. Apart from this, people who show excessive physical activity may experience heat cramps. Apart from this, heat edema, sunburn, heat exhaustion can be seen in cases such as heat exhaustion. All of these conditions I have mentioned are the early effects of extreme temperatures. Some effects may also occur in the late period due to long-term exposure. Among these, cataracts, sun spots, premature aging and skin cancers, one of the conditions we do not want, may occur.''

Underlining that one should not go out between 10.00-16.00 unless necessary, Albayrak said, “We should stay at home as much as possible. We should not sunbathe or swim in the sea during these hours. Our citizens who will enter the sea should use sunscreen with at least 30 protection factors and wear sunglasses. People who will work under the sun need to take some protective measures. Among these precautions, they should prefer light, loose, light-colored clothes woven from tight fabric. Apart from this, one of the most important points is fluid consumption. At least 2, 2.5 liters of fluid should be consumed daily. First of all, our liquid preference should of course be water. Apart from this, milk, ayran, freshly squeezed fruit juices should be preferred instead of coffee, tea, carbonated drinks. In order to increase body resistance and provide the body with the necessary vitamins and minerals, plenty of vegetables and fruits should be consumed. Fatty foods should be avoided, boiling, cooking in its own juice or grilling methods should be preferred instead of frying. In addition, patients with diuretic use or fluid restriction such as chronic heart disease, chronic kidney disease, chronic liver disease should consult their own doctors when organizing their diets.
